AN ASSESSMENT OF THE SOCIOECONOMIC IMPACTS OF ENERGY DEVELOPMENT IN NORTHEASTERN UTAH VOLUME IV

Three counties in the Uintah Basin in the northeastern corner of Utah, which could be the site of numerous energy development projects in the next two decades, are the focus of this report. Socioeconomic characteristics of the area, as they presently exist, are described as a baseline for comparison of impact projections. Topics include population, land use, housing, transporation, community services, employment and imcome, public finances, local political profile, and social and psychological aspects. Impacts, through the year 2000 where possible, of growth from energy development are discussed for each of these topics.
